TILT/TELESCOPING STEERING
COLUMN
This feature allows you to tilt the steering
column upward or downward. It also al-
lows you to lengthen or shorten the steer-
ing column. The tilt/telescoping control
handle is located below the steering wheel
at the end of the steering column.
To unlock the steering column, push the
control handle downward. To tilt the steer-
ing column, move the steering wheel up-
ward or downward as desired. To lengthen
or shorten the steering column, pull the
steering wheel outward or push it inward
as desired. To lock the steering column in
position, pull the control handle upward
until fully engaged.
WARNING!
Do not adjust the steering column
while driving. Adjusting the steering
column while driving or driving with
the steering column unlocked could
cause the driver to lose control of the
vehicle. Be sure the steering column
is locked before driving your vehicle.
Failure to follow this warning may
result in serious injury or death.
ELECTRONIC SPEED
CONTROL — IF EQUIPPED
When engaged, the Electronic Speed
Control takes over accelerator operations
at speeds greater than 25 mph (40 km/h).
The Electronic Speed Control buttons are
located on the right side of the steering
wheel.
